Abstract

The purpose of the present invention is to provide a polishing composition which can polish an object to be polished containing oxygen atoms and silicon atoms at high polishing speed, and can reduce generation of scratches on a surface of the object to be polished. A polishing composition used for polishing an object to be polished containing oxygen atoms and silicon atoms, the polishing composition including: abrasive grains A having an average primary particle size of 3 nm or more and 8 nm or less; abrasive grains B having an average primary particle size of more than 8 nm; and a dispersing medium, wherein a content of the abrasive grains B in the polishing composition is larger than a content of the abrasive grains A in the polishing composition, average silanol group density of the abrasive grains A and the abrasive grains B is 2.0 nmor less, and an aspect ratio of the abrasive grains B is more than 1.3 and 2.0 or less.
